Abstract

Official abstract text for this publication.

It is intended to improve usability while securing functionality of a sound output device. There are provided: a neck band to be worn on a user's neck and having an insertion hole; a cable partially led out from the neck band; and an earphone connected to the cable. The cable can be drawn out from the neck band to both sides of the insertion hole, and a length of a portion on both sides of the insertion hole in the cable is changed by changing a position of an inserted portion of the cable in the insertion hole. Since a length of each portion of the cable positioned on both sides of the insertion hole is changed by changing a position of the inserted portion of the cable, it is possible to improve usability while securing functionality of the sound output device.

The invention claimed is: 1. A sound output device, comprising: a neck band wearable on a user neck, wherein the neck band includes: an intermediate unit that is one of curved or at least partially bent, wherein the intermediate unit includes a first end and a second end; a first arrangement unit at the first end of the intermediate unit; a second arrangement unit at the second end of the intermediate unit, wherein each of the first arrangement unit and the second arrangement unit comprises an internal structure; and an insertion hole in each of the first arrangement unit and the second arrangement unit, wherein the insertion hole includes a first portion and a second portion, the first portion extends in a specific direction, and the second portion is inclined with respect to the first portion; a cable partially led out from the neck band; and an earphone connected to the cable, wherein the cable is drawable from the neck band to both a first side of the insertion hole and a second side of the insertion hole, and a length of a portion of the cable on both the first side of the insertion hole and the second side of the insertion hole is changeable based on change of a position of an inserted portion of the cable in the insertion hole. 2. The sound output device according to claim 1 , wherein a diameter of each of the first arrangement unit and the second arrangement unit is larger than a diameter of the intermediate unit. 3. The sound output device according to claim 1 , wherein in a state where the neck band is worn on the user neck, the first arrangement unit is spaced apart from the second arrangement unit and the first arrangement unit is on a left side of the user neck and the second arrangement unit is on a right side of the user neck, and in a case where an inner side of the first arrangement unit faces an inner side the second arrangement unit, the first side of the insertion hole is on each of the inner side of the first arrangement unit and the inner side of the second arrangement unit, and the second side of the insertion hole is on each of an outer side of the first arrangement unit and an outer surface of the second arrangement unit. 4. The sound output device according to claim 1 , wherein in a state where the neck band is worn on the user neck, the first arrangement unit is spaced apart from the second arrangement unit, and the first arrangement unit is on left side of the user neck and the second arrangement unit is on right of the user neck, and in a case where an inner side of the first arrangement unit faces an inner side of the second arrangement unit, each of the first side of the insertion hole and the second side of the insertion hole is on the inner side of the first arrangement unit and the inner side of the second arrangement unit. 5. The sound output device according to claim 1 , wherein each of the first arrangement unit and the second arrangement unit further comprises a lead-out opening, the cable is led out through the lead-out opening, and the insertion hole is closer to the intermediate unit than the lead-out opening. 6. The sound output device according to claim 1 , wherein each of the first arrangement unit and the second arrangement unit further comprises a lead-out opening; the cable is led out through the lead-out opening, and the lead-out opening is closer to the intermediate unit than the insertion hole. 7. The sound output device according to claim 1 , wherein the cable is configured to support a first stopper and a second stopper, and each of the first stopper and the second stopper is configured to restrict a movement of the cable with respect to the neck band. 8. The sound output device according to claim 7 , wherein each of the first stopper and the second stopper is supported slidably by the cable. 9. The sound output device according to claim 7 , wherein at least a part of each of the first stopper or the second stopper is insertable in the insertion hole. 10. The sound output device according to claim 9 , wherein a diameter of at least a part of the insertion hole decreases towards inward direction in the neck band. 11. The sound output device according to claim 7 , wherein an end portion of the cable is connected with the earphone, and the first stopper is between the end portion of the cable and the inserted portion of the cable. 12. The sound output device according to claim 11 , wherein an outer shape of the first stopper is a truncated cone shape. 13. The sound output device according to claim 7 , wherein each of the first arrangement unit and the second arrangement unit further comprises a lead-out opening; the cable is led out through the lead-out opening, a portion of the cable in the lead-out opening is a lead-out starting end, and the second stopper is between the lead-out starting end of the cable and the inserted portion of the cable. 14. The sound output device according to claim 7 , wherein the first stopper is opposite to the second stopper, and the inserted portion is in between the first stopper and the second stopper. 15. The sound output device according to claim 14 , wherein a shape of the first stopper is different from a shape of the second stopper. 16. The sound output device according to claim 1 , wherein the internal structure comprises a communication device, and the communication device is at a tip end portion of one of the first arrangement unit or the second arrangement unit.
